The Rocky Mountain Military Affairs Society is pleased to announce an upcoming lecture, 'In the Name of War: Race and Effigy in the Making of an American Identity During the Korean War,' by Dr. Cameron McCoy, Department of History, USAF Academy.
The RMMAS seeks to educate the public about warfare and military issues, past and present, through presentations and publications by scholars and other subject matter experts.
